Nummer3080LeitungCatherine Bartl Shultis, catherine.shultis@fhnw.chUnterrichtsspracheEnglischLernziele/KompetenzenStudents will achieve a C1 level (Council of Europe’s Common European Framework of Reference for Languages) after 3 semesters of English. This will enable students to fully participate academically or professionally in the field of geomatics. Students will be introduced to digital resources and tools to promote self-study and a lifelong use of the English language.InhaltThe four skills of reading, writing, listening and speaking as well as grammar and vocabulary will be revised and expanded upon.
Reading and writing: students will continue to improve their skills (both at the sentence, paragraph and genre level) through a variety of technical and general English texts. They will produce a portfolio of written texts.
Speaking and listening: students will increase their confidence and fluency in managing spoken discourse in a variety of contexts, while being exposed to native and non-native varieties of English. In this semester, students will present to their classmates.
Grammar and vocabulary: students will learn technical terms related to geomatics as well as to general English. Grammar at the B1-B2 level will be revised.LeistungsbewertungGemäss Prüfungs- und Studienordnung für den Bachelorstudiengang Geomatik
